Good morning in hebrew. Shalom, like many Hebrew words, has more than one meaning. Shalom Is Peace. Shalom means peace, and is rooted in the word שלם (shaleim), which means completion. Without peace, there can be no completion... Shalom Is a Greeting. Shalom is also commonly used as a greeting and salutation and can mean both "hello" and "goodby." Shalom Is the ...

Gamar hatimah tova (gmar tov)[Pronounced ga-mar ha-ti-mah toh-vah] A traditional of the Jewish greetings for Yom Kippur is “Gamar hatimah tovah.”. Some say “Gmar tov,” meaning a good completion to your inscription (in the book of life). This greeting (and closing) is used between Rosh Hashanah and the end of Yom Kippur. Yours, Tal. בתרגום לעברית על ידי אתר מורפיקס, מילון עברי אנגלי ואנגלי עברי חינמי המוביל ברשת good morningDec 4, 2023 · In Hebrew, saying 'good morning' is a way to wish someone a positive start to their day. The phrase is "boker tov" (בוקר טוב), where "boker" stands for morning and "tov" means good. Combining these words creates a delightful wish for a pleasant morning. MORNING. mor'-ning: There are several Hebrew and Greek words which are rendered "morning," the most common in Hebrew being boqer, which occurs 180 times. It properly means "the breaking forth of the light," "the dawn," as in Genesis 19:27; Judges 19:8,25,27. Another word with the same meaning is shachar ( Genesis 19:15; Nehemiah 4:21; Isaiah 58 ...
